Great way to get an overview of Vegas and to save some walking. I say some, because a lot of the stops are out of the way and we had to walk a long way to find the stop (directions to some stops weren't clear). I would almost recommend riding it all the way around once so you see where the stops are. Some of the tour guides are good (Jackie and Jason were The Best!). One bus we were on, the driver was awful, running red lights and stop signs, not waiting at stops - and the narrator could care less about what he was supposed to be doing. A companion actually asked him if this was his last run for the day he acted so tired and bored. (And of course that team didn't give us their names). Overall it's worth the money.
